Lost Laptops, no Replacement

Cars & Transport

Today I received a final email from Gail Arendse, claims manager at Skynet in South Africa. In this mail she denied our insurance claim for 2 laptops that were transported by Skynet, but that went missing in transit. Skynet has refused to accept responsibility for their role in this loss.

Their waybill asks you to tick if you would like insurance over R1000. We ticked this, thinking that this was all that was required to make sure our laptops were insured during transit. However, because we did not specify the exact amount in the waybill, they have denied liability for our lost goods.

The Skynet waybill seems to be deliberately misleading, as the section where you ask for insurance above R1000 and the section where you specify the exact amount insured are far apart. They do not seem to be connected questions and this is misleading.
